Pablo Larrosa Rivero

CTO at Conexio

Pablo Larrosa Rivero has a diverse work experience spanning over a decade. Pablo started their career as a Web Developer at Clicking | Team Communication in 2006. In 2007, they joined Tata Consultancy Services where they worked as a Software Developer on various projects for international clients. At Tata Consultancy Services, they also completed courses in Java Certification 1.4 and Technologies Struts, JPA, and JSF.

In 2009, Pablo joined CITS as a Software Developer and was involved in software development for the Ceibal Project, which aimed to provide computer systems to primary and high schools across the country. During their time at CITS, they also completed the Oracle Workshop 1 course.

From 2012 to 2014, Pablo worked as a Senior Java Developer at Pyxis, where they were responsible for migrating existing software applications for the National telecommunications provider, Antel, from Java 1.4 and Jboss 4.2 to Java 1.x.

In 2014, Pablo joined Conexio as a member of their Adobe Experience Manager (AEM) team. Pablo initially served as an AEM Technical Lead, developing front-end and back-end solutions for clients in the Healthcare, Aeronautics, Automaker, Management Consulting, and Renewable Energy sectors. Pablo also played a role in configuring the AWS instance used by Conexio for AEM migrations.

Later at Conexio, Pablo took on the role of Chief Technology Officer (CTO), where they trained senior Java developers in Adobe CQ/AEM and led several projects, contributing to the analysis of current solutions and gathering requirements during the early phases of projects. Pablo also provided support to the internal Conexio team throughout project execution.

Overall, Pablo Larrosa Rivero has gained significant experience in web development, software development, Java programming, and Adobe Experience Manager, contributing their expertise to a wide range of projects in various industries.

Pablo Larrosa Rivero completed their education at Universidad ORT Uruguay, where they obtained a degree as an Ingeniero en Sistemas in Computer Software Engineering in 2014. In addition to their academic qualifications, they have also obtained various certifications from Adobe. These certifications include ACE AEM 6 Architect, ACE AEM 6 Developer, Adobe Certified Expert - Adobe Analytics Developer, and Adobe Certified Expert – Adobe Real-Time CDP, which were obtained in 2017, 2016, 2022, and 2022 respectively. Pablo also holds certifications as an AEM Architect and Adobe Campaign Standard Business Practitioner, however, the specific dates for obtaining these certifications are not available.
